语音接口让AI更易用,却可能加剧性别偏见。

Greater accessibility can amplify discrimination in generative AI

  • 语音输入使模型根据声音自动判断性别并产生刻板印象
  • 语音交互的偏见程度高于文本,且1000人调查证实用户反感
  • 调节语音音高可减轻歧视,适合政策制定者和伦理设计者

数亿人依赖大语言模型进行教育、工作甚至医疗。然而这些模型会复制并放大训练数据中的社会偏见。文本界面对读写能力弱、有运动障碍或仅使用手机的用户构成障碍。语音交互虽能提升可及性,但语音自带身份线索,用户难以隐藏,引发公平性担忧。我们发现,支持语音的LLM会基于说话者声音系统性地偏向性别刻板印象,如职业和形容词选择,其偏见程度超过文本交互。补充调查显示,1000名用户中不常使用聊天机器人的群体最反感属性推断,一旦知晓会更易放弃使用。实验表明,调节语音音高可有效控制性别歧视输出。研究揭示:通过语音扩展可及性的同时,可能引入新的歧视路径,需将公平与可及性同步考虑。

原文摘要 · Abstract (English)

Hundreds of millions of people rely on large language models (LLMs) for education, work, and even healthcare. Yet these models are known to reproduce and amplify social biases present in their training data. Moreover, text-based interfaces remain a barrier for many, for example, users with limited literacy, motor impairments, or mobile-only devices. Voice interaction promises to expand accessibility, but unlike text, speech carries identity cues that users cannot easily mask, raising concerns about whether accessibility gains may come at the cost of equitable treatment. Here we show that audio-enabled LLMs exhibit systematic gender discrimination, shifting responses toward gender-stereotyped adjectives and occupations solely on the basis of speaker voice, and amplifying bias beyond that observed in text-based interaction. Thus, voice interfaces do not merely extend text models to a new modality but introduce distinct bias mechanisms tied to paralinguistic cues. Complementary survey evidence ($n=1,000$) shows that infrequent chatbot users are most hesitant to undisclosed attribute inference and most likely to disengage when such practices are revealed. To demonstrate a potential mitigation strategy, we show that pitch manipulation can systematically regulate gender-discriminatory outputs. Overall, our findings reveal a critical tension in AI development: efforts to expand accessibility through voice interfaces simultaneously create new pathways for discrimination, demanding that fairness and accessibility be addressed in tandem.
